Grayhill Appoints element14 as Authorised Distributor For its Precision Switches

- Advertisement -

Other products available via element14 include optical encoders and joysticks, rotary switches, keypads, pushbuttons and touch encoders

In a recent update, element14 announced that Grayhill designated the company as an authorised distributor for the Asia-Pacific region,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. Saying that its precision switches are used in a range of human-machine interface (HMI) solutions, the company noted that the new agreement offers element14 customers fast delivery of “high-quality HMI products” for design into OEM systems across these regions. As per the press release, precision medical devices and defence applications, including emergency responder radios, as well as luxury car manufacturers and rugged interfaces for off-road vehicles widely use Grayhill products.

Global Product Segment Leader for Switches at element14, Keith Forbes remarked, “The rise of haptics in the field of touchscreens and many other human interface devices is an area of expertise that runs deep at Grayhill. Their product lines of rotary switches and encoders will enable developers and OEM manufacturers to access and deliver the finest components for their projects on fast lead times from our stock. The addition of the Grayhill range adds even greater depth to our inventory of sought-after components and further reinforces element14 as a service and support leader in these regions.”

“This new agreement provides the means to deliver Grayhill’s products across EMEA and APAC with the advantages of local stock. Our products offer customers precision and functionality for touch displays, keypads, and rotary switches that can support multiple languages and end-product configurations, all backed by Grayhill’s depth of experience and history of innovation,” commented Karen Entriken, Grayhill’s director of marketing.

element14, an Avnet company and global distributor of electronic components, products and solutions was founded in 1986. It aims to support design engineers by offering a range of products in its comprehensive semiconductor portfolio. It recently associated with Piera to distribute the latter’s particle sensors.

1943-found Grayhill identifies as a committed provider of top-quality human interface solutions for a wide range of applications.
